Subject: Re: [PATCH 4/4] arm64: dts: qcom: ipq5424: Enable cpufreq support

On 27.01.2025 10:31 AM, Sricharan R wrote:
> From: Sricharan Ramabadhran <quic_srichara@...cinc.com>

subject: you're not enabling support, you're either enabling cpufreq (the
feature), or adding support for it

> Add the qfprom, cpu clocks, A53 PLL and cpu-opp-table required for
> CPU clock scaling.
> 
> Signed-off-by: Sricharan Ramabadhran <quic_srichara@...cinc.com>
> ---

[...]

> +	cpu_opp_table: opp-table-cpu {
> +		compatible = "operating-points-v2-kryo-cpu";
> +		opp-shared;
> +		nvmem-cells = <&cpu_speed_bin>;
> +
> +		/*
> +		 * CPU supports two frequencies and the fuse has LValue instead
> +		 * of limits. As only two frequencies are supported, considering
> +		 * zero Lvalue as no limit and Lvalue as 1.4GHz limit.
> +		 * ------------------------------------------------------------
> +		 * Frequency     BIT1    BIT0    opp-supported-hw
> +		 *	      1.4GHz  No Limit
> +		 * ------------------------------------------------------------
> +		 * 1416000000      1       1	    0x3
> +		 * 1800000000      0       1	    0x1
> +		 * ------------------------------------------------------------
> +		 */

This is trivially inferred from the nodes below
